Lines Matching refs:m
137 static int ppc_rtas_sensors_show(struct seq_file *m, void *v);
138 static int ppc_rtas_clock_show(struct seq_file *m, void *v);
141 static int ppc_rtas_progress_show(struct seq_file *m, void *v);
144 static int ppc_rtas_poweron_show(struct seq_file *m, void *v);
150 static int ppc_rtas_tone_freq_show(struct seq_file *m, void *v);
153 static int ppc_rtas_tone_volume_show(struct seq_file *m, void *v);
154 static int ppc_rtas_rmo_buf_show(struct seq_file *m, void *v);
246 static void ppc_rtas_process_sensor(struct seq_file *m,
249 static void get_location_code(struct seq_file *m,
251 static void check_location_string(struct seq_file *m, const char *c);
252 static void check_location(struct seq_file *m, const char *c);
327 static int ppc_rtas_poweron_show(struct seq_file *m, void *v) in ppc_rtas_poweron_show() argument
330 seq_printf(m, "Power on time not set\n"); in ppc_rtas_poweron_show()
332 seq_printf(m, "%lu\n",power_on_time); in ppc_rtas_poweron_show()
361 static int ppc_rtas_progress_show(struct seq_file *m, void *v) in ppc_rtas_progress_show() argument
364 seq_printf(m, "%s\n", progress_led); in ppc_rtas_progress_show()
390 static int ppc_rtas_clock_show(struct seq_file *m, void *v) in ppc_rtas_clock_show() argument
398 seq_printf(m, "0"); in ppc_rtas_clock_show()
403 seq_printf(m, "%lu\n", in ppc_rtas_clock_show()
412 static int ppc_rtas_sensors_show(struct seq_file *m, void *v) in ppc_rtas_sensors_show() argument
418 seq_printf(m, "RTAS (RunTime Abstraction Services) Sensor Information\n"); in ppc_rtas_sensors_show()
419 seq_printf(m, "Sensor\t\tValue\t\tCondition\tLocation\n"); in ppc_rtas_sensors_show()
420 seq_printf(m, "********************************************************\n"); in ppc_rtas_sensors_show()
423 seq_printf(m, "\nNo sensors are available\n"); in ppc_rtas_sensors_show()
441 ppc_rtas_process_sensor(m, p, state, error, loc); in ppc_rtas_sensors_show()
442 seq_putc(m, '\n'); in ppc_rtas_sensors_show()
513 static void ppc_rtas_process_sensor(struct seq_file *m, in ppc_rtas_process_sensor() argument
544 seq_printf(m, "Key switch:\t"); in ppc_rtas_process_sensor()
547 seq_printf(m, "%s\t", key_switch[state]); in ppc_rtas_process_sensor()
552 seq_printf(m, "Enclosure switch:\t"); in ppc_rtas_process_sensor()
555 seq_printf(m, "%s\t", in ppc_rtas_process_sensor()
561 seq_printf(m, "Temp. (C/F):\t"); in ppc_rtas_process_sensor()
565 seq_printf(m, "Lid status:\t"); in ppc_rtas_process_sensor()
568 seq_printf(m, "%s\t", lid_status[state]); in ppc_rtas_process_sensor()
573 seq_printf(m, "Power source:\t"); in ppc_rtas_process_sensor()
576 seq_printf(m, "%s\t", in ppc_rtas_process_sensor()
582 seq_printf(m, "Battery voltage:\t"); in ppc_rtas_process_sensor()
585 seq_printf(m, "Battery remaining:\t"); in ppc_rtas_process_sensor()
589 seq_printf(m, "%s\t", in ppc_rtas_process_sensor()
595 seq_printf(m, "Battery percentage:\t"); in ppc_rtas_process_sensor()
598 seq_printf(m, "EPOW Sensor:\t"); in ppc_rtas_process_sensor()
601 seq_printf(m, "%s\t", epow_sensor[state]); in ppc_rtas_process_sensor()
606 seq_printf(m, "Battery cyclestate:\t"); in ppc_rtas_process_sensor()
610 seq_printf(m, "%s\t", in ppc_rtas_process_sensor()
616 seq_printf(m, "Battery Charging:\t"); in ppc_rtas_process_sensor()
619 seq_printf(m, "%s\t", in ppc_rtas_process_sensor()
625 seq_printf(m, "Surveillance:\t"); in ppc_rtas_process_sensor()
628 seq_printf(m, "Fan (rpm):\t"); in ppc_rtas_process_sensor()
631 seq_printf(m, "Voltage (mv):\t"); in ppc_rtas_process_sensor()
634 seq_printf(m, "DR connector:\t"); in ppc_rtas_process_sensor()
637 seq_printf(m, "%s\t", in ppc_rtas_process_sensor()
643 seq_printf(m, "Powersupply:\t"); in ppc_rtas_process_sensor()
646 seq_printf(m, "Unknown sensor (type %d), ignoring it\n", in ppc_rtas_process_sensor()
654 seq_printf(m, "%4d /%4d\t", state, cel_to_fahr(state)); in ppc_rtas_process_sensor()
656 seq_printf(m, "%10d\t", state); in ppc_rtas_process_sensor()
659 seq_printf(m, "%s\t", ppc_rtas_process_error(error)); in ppc_rtas_process_sensor()
660 get_location_code(m, s, loc); in ppc_rtas_process_sensor()
666 static void check_location(struct seq_file *m, const char *c) in check_location() argument
670 seq_printf(m, "Planar #%c", c[1]); in check_location()
673 seq_printf(m, "CPU #%c", c[1]); in check_location()
676 seq_printf(m, "Fan #%c", c[1]); in check_location()
679 seq_printf(m, "Rack #%c", c[1]); in check_location()
682 seq_printf(m, "Voltage #%c", c[1]); in check_location()
685 seq_printf(m, "LCD #%c", c[1]); in check_location()
688 seq_printf(m, "- %c", c[1]); in check_location()
691 seq_printf(m, "Unknown location"); in check_location()
703 static void check_location_string(struct seq_file *m, const char *c) in check_location_string() argument
707 check_location(m, c); in check_location_string()
709 seq_printf(m, " at "); in check_location_string()
717 static void get_location_code(struct seq_file *m, struct individual_sensor *s, in get_location_code() argument
721 seq_printf(m, "---");/* does not have a location */ in get_location_code()
723 check_location_string(m, loc); in get_location_code()
725 seq_putc(m, ' '); in get_location_code()
747 static int ppc_rtas_tone_freq_show(struct seq_file *m, void *v) in ppc_rtas_tone_freq_show() argument
749 seq_printf(m, "%lu\n", rtas_tone_frequency); in ppc_rtas_tone_freq_show()
775 static int ppc_rtas_tone_volume_show(struct seq_file *m, void *v) in ppc_rtas_tone_volume_show() argument
777 seq_printf(m, "%lu\n", rtas_tone_volume); in ppc_rtas_tone_volume_show()
784 static int ppc_rtas_rmo_buf_show(struct seq_file *m, void *v) in ppc_rtas_rmo_buf_show() argument
786 seq_printf(m, "%016lx %x\n", rtas_rmo_buf, RTAS_RMOBUF_MAX); in ppc_rtas_rmo_buf_show()